MatchesFashion joins 15 Percent Pledge
On Monday, MatchesFashion became the first Uk-dependent business to be a part of the 15 Percent Pledge. Black-owned enterprises at present make up only 3% of the designers it shares, but the luxury e-commerce web-site claimed it now programs to devote 15% of its purchasing price range to manufacturers that are owned, established or fronted by Black persons by 2026. Nordstrom’s BP debuts ongoing collaboration with Wildfang
Nordstrom’s BP model has teamed up with Wildfang on an ongoing collaboration. The 1st selection drops Monday and it features coveralls, button ups, blazers, assertion tees and equipment that are priced from $12 to $89. Foremost up to the start, Nordstrom expended 18 months operating with Wildfang on an immersive partnership that included gender expertise teaching for workers, product model/suit analysis, social responsibility initiatives and promoting segmentation.
